Industrial wastewater is divided into phenol wastewater, mercury-containing wastewater, oil-containing wastewater, heavy metal wastewater, cyanide-containing wastewater, Paper mill wastewater, printing and dyeing wastewater, chemical industry wastewater, metallurgical wastewater, acid-base wastewater, etc., different wastewater has different treatment methods.
